MEMO — Kettling Depot Receiving

Uniform sets for the new Kettling depot arrive Wednesday via Ashgrove courier: 40 boxes, sorted by size, manifest attached to box one. Check the count at the dock before signing; shortages go straight to stores, not the courier. The hand-over instruction the courier will follow is set out below.

drop instructions, tafof-baguf: the holmir gilox courier leaves the sormir ulaok holdor ledger at gate 5596 under passcode 257343

Welcome to on-call for the Glimmerpane design system! Our snapshot tests live in the `snapcheck` suite and run on every merge to main. If a UI component changes visually, the diff bot flags it — usually it's an intentional tweak, so just approve the new baseline. If it's 2am and snapshots are failing across the board, it's almost always a font-loading race, not your problem. To unlock the baseline store and re-approve snapshots in bulk, use the recovery passphrase below.

recovery phrase for tahag-taguf: wenix-caswyn

Handover note — Crumbwheel order cutoffs.

Welcome aboard. The bakery cutoff rule in Crumbwheel closes same-day orders at 14:00 local to each storefront, not UTC — this has bitten us twice. Holiday overrides live in the calendar service and take precedence silently, so always check there first when a cutoff looks wrong. To unlock the calendar service's admin console after a restart, enter the recovery passphrase below.

vault phrase of bagap-bahaf = silion-pelox-sorox-casdor-quenwyn-fraax-eliox-praael-kelion-quenvan-kasox-rusael-norius-belvan